Sunday 26th May

 A singing male GOLDEN ORIOLE was briefly on the north side of Castle Hill before moving off south. Six Sanderling, 4 Dunlin and one Little Ringed Plover were on East Lake at North Yorkshire Water Park. Four singing Sedge Warblers at Seamer tip, a Water Rail in a ditch there. Two Avocets, a drake Garganey, a Shoveler pair with 6 young, Barnacle Goose*, 3 Ringed Plovers, 5 Dunlin, 2 Sanderling, 8 Little Egrets, 60 House Martins, 80 Swifts, 2 Yellow Wagtails, and a Short-eared Owl were at Potter Brompton Carr. An Osprey flew south over Gristhorpe early afternoon. Two Spotted Flycatchers, 2 Whimbrel and a Raven were at Gristhorpe Bay this afternoon. A Red Kite was seen at Sherburn. 

* Today's Barnacle Goose (neck collar B97) : ringed at Scorton in July 2022 has regularly frequented Saltholme, but aslso seen in Kent, East Sussex and in Lincolnshire (all Jan 2023). It was at Saltholme in Jan 2024, but in Bavaria by February. The last sighting from Lower Saxony in March!
